NBA FINALS: KNICKS VS. SPURS


June 10, 2026


Keldon Johnson


San Antonio Spurs

Game 4: Postgame


Q. What was the difference in the second half? What changed?

KELDON JOHNSON: We got away from what put us in the position we were in during the first half. That's what it boils down to. They made some shots. They made some runs. It came back to bite us in the end.

Q. What did it feel like in the locker room after the game?

KELDON JOHNSON: It hurts. We gave this one up. It hurts. I think it hurts everybody, from players to staff. We put a lot into it. As much as it hurts, we're still playing. We have 48, 72 hours to get back at it, and I wouldn't want to be with any other guys. I feel like we have a special group. We're back at it, and we believe we can get it done. That's not going to change regardless.

Q. Is this the craziest game you've been a part of?

KELDON JOHNSON: Yeah. It's a tough one, a tough pill to swallow. I feel like we got comfortable and things happen. But I think the main thing is that belief is there. We believe. Our belief is as high as ever. You don't get here without belief, without faith in each other, and that's not going to change now. If it was easy, everybody would do it.

Q. As strong as that belief is, when they were making their run in the second half, was some of that belief tested for a while? Did it rattle you guys in any way?

KELDON JOHNSON: No. I feel like even up to the last buzzer, we believed that we were going to win or that we were supposed to win. When you have a group like us, shots going in, that doesn't waver us. We continue to stay together, and we're going to continue to pull even closer and get the job done.

Q. Any other emotions outside of just the belief? I know you have another one Saturday, but any other emotions that are just kind of on the surface right now?

KELDON JOHNSON: I mean, we're all human. It hurts. We want to win. We're so close, but so far. We're going to continue to do what we do, bring our brand of basketball and correct the things that we can correct going forward. I believe, one through 15, that when we step out there, whoever steps on the court, we're going out there to get the job done.

Q. You guys are now on the brink of elimination in the playoffs. You've seen what a home crowd can do here with the run in the fourth quarter from New York. What do you guys need to see from not only you guys on the floor, but San Antonio in Game 5?

KELDON JOHNSON: Our fans show up every time. They've been showing up since I've been here. I know our fans will be who they are. We expect no less, no different. We go back home and approach it one game at a time, one possession at a time, and get the job done.
